Warehouse packer, warehouse picker shipping and receiving forklift driver palatalizing pallets web orders and sorter.Operate cherry-picker to retrieve items from various locations.Prepare pallets by following prescribe stacking arrangement and properly tagging pallet.Order picking, putaway, checking in inbound & loading out bound trucks.Fill orders by hand picking, shipping through FedEx ups and usps.Perform QA on bags and codes prior to warehouse pickup and shipping.Pack and ship out large and small car parts through fed ex. ![]() Labele and price items such as clothing, groceries, etc.Perform computerized RF tuning test to ensure quality of units.Scan UPC barcode and then forward packages to shipping.Pull orders and run forklift pack on skids and wrapped.complete usps and ups orders and do labels.reach truck, stand up, dock truck, and clamp truck. ![]() 7/21/2023 0 Comments Arausio theater![]() ![]() 1 In this respect, at least, 'fragmentology' finds itself in methodological harmony with a rather different type of reconstructive project: the history and analysis of ancient dramatic performance. The study of fragments, dramatic or otherwise, inevitably involves 'an element of creative fiction (which is not a dirty word),' as Matthew Wright has recently so aptly observed. Such exposure of the process of theatrical representation, I argue, can draw the audience in as a co-participant in a drama's production. Sometimes there are multiple representational possibilities for physical space within and around the theater sometimes physical and fictional space are to be seen simultaneously sometimes the representational gap between physical and fictional space is kept open for a surprisingly long time. I focus on opening scenes in plays by Sophocles and Aristophanes where a character sees with and for the audience, and demonstrate how these moments of staged spectatorship are not necessarily straightforward or seamless they can facilitate the viewing of dramatic space but also, by laying it bare, reveal its complications. Drawing from theater scholarship on the phenomenology of space, I show how tragedians and comedians alike experimented with how to shape their audience's understanding of a play's setting. This paper explores the construction of dramatic space in the prologues of classical Greek drama. ![]() ![]() Furthermore, by indulging in a synkrisis of comic and tragic performance poetics of fifth-century drama, it engages in the wider debate on tragedy as genre and its development in the late fifth century. By focusing on staging technique, this paper rereads the Helen through a different lens. The context and the way of handling staging motifs reinforce the association with the comic trope. What has not received sufficient emphasis in previous analyses is the profound extent to which this interaction between genres operates on several levels: dramatic space, blocking, proxemics, and skeue. In any reading, the wit and playfulness of this play cannot be dismissed. Irony and a sense of amusement are inherent in the multiple paradoxes which Euripides’ new, chaste and noble, Helen has to face. Elements of comedy and satyr play have been detected at work at the level of plot, individual scenes, characterisation and use of motifs. By focusing on Euripides’ configuration of various aspects of opsis, this paper argues that the inter-generic give-and-take in the construction of plot and theme is strikingly replicated in the granularity of the staging technique. Comicality penetrates Euripides’ Helen much deeper than so far noticed. ![]() 7/21/2023 0 Comments On sute shred company arkansas![]() ![]() To keep up with his continuing work, you can follow Alexander on Instagram, Read this Postīen speaking at the Capitol Visitors Center His latest project, a YouTube series titled Life with Cerebral Palsy | Q & A, is described on his film production company OUTCAST Productions’ YouTube channel as “Everything you wanted to know about living with a disability, especially cerebral palsy, but didn’t know how to ask.” Everyone must have moments where they have to look back and say thank you for all your help.”Īlexander’s disability advocacy continues the spirit of helping others along the way. ”Īlexander on location filming The Wounds We Cannot See.Īlexander shared, “A lot of the technology that I used was directly from Easterseals, so I started working with an Easterseals technology specialist when I was really little, and then that continued as I got older and grew up.”Īlexander has one thing he wants everyone to take away from his story: “I am only where I am today because of a lot of people who helped me along the way, and I think that is a very important lesson, not just for me or people with disabilities, but a lesson to people in general…No one gets where they are on their own.
